Samples of Russet Burbank and Kennebec seed potatoes
used by Oregon growers were grown in replicated plots at
Klamath Falls, Prineville and Corvallis. Observations
were made of total yield, yield of U.S. No. 1 tubers and
number of stems produced per plot.

The effect of clipping and supplemental nitrogen application on
seed production of Linn perennial ryegrass and Merion Kentucky bluegrass
was studied. Clipping and nitrogen treatments did not significantly
affect the seed yield of Linn perennial ryegrass during the 1967
growing season. The seed yield of Merion Kentucky bluegrass was

This study was undertaken to better understand plant characteristics
related to high and low forage yield in tall fescue selections
as affected by temperature. Dry matter distribution into yield components
in three different temperature regimes was evaluated. Root
growth, dark respiration and nutrient concentration were also examined.
